What is 5/6 as a decimal?

5/6 as a decimal is 0.833...

The fraction has two parts- the numerator and the denominator. The number at the top is called the numerator and the number at the bottom is called the denominator.

A fraction can be written in its decimal form by dividing the numerator by the denominator.

Remember that in a division the number that is divided is called the dividend and the number that divides is called the divisor. The resulting answer is called the quotient.

Solution

Let’s divide 5 by 6. Note that since 5 cannot be divided by 6, you can add zeros (in red) to the dividend by placing a decimal point in the quotient.

Here we can see that once we place the decimal point in the quotient, we can keep adding 0 at each level to make the number divisible.
It can be seen that the division is repeating. Hence the answer is 0.83……. This is written as $$0.8\overline3$$.

The decimals that have one or more numbers repeated are called the repeating decimals. The digits that are repeated are denoted by placing a bar over them.
